Esplendor Resort at Rio Rico

The Esplendor Resort at Rio Rico is Rio Rico's central tourist attraction and its only hotel/resort. Overlooking the Santa Cruz River, the resort rests on the 18-hole Rio Rico Golf Course and provides close to 200 rooms and suites. The resort includes an outdoor pool, fitness center, tennis courts, business center, and restaurant and grill. Pets are welcome at this resort.

Tubac Golf Resort & Spa

Resting just a few miles north of Rio Rico sits the Tubac Golf Resort & Spa. This hotel and resort sits on a 500-acre ranch and offers its visitors a wide array of fine cuisine, golfing opportunities, and relaxing spas and surroundings. Explore Rio Rico with Tubac's mountain biking and horseback riding trails, or set your sights on the stars from the 9,000-foot high observatory.

Artist's Suites

The Artist's Suites are just a few short miles from Rio Rico in Tubac, Arizona. The hotel is a gathering place for artists and admirers, and is located in the Aldea de Artisticas, a prime location for artist studios and galleries. The guest rooms include sitting rooms with fireplaces, private bathrooms with artistic designs and paintings, and cactus patio gardens. Its complimentary guest services include continental breakfast, expert concierge services, and home office amenities such as Internet and Wi-Fi services.

Frida's Inn

Frida's Inn is a premier bed and breakfast that rests just south of Rio Rico. The inn is located in a historic masonry house and sits just one mile from the International Arizona-Mexico border. The inn provides a relaxing and nature-rich atmosphere that is ideal for private weddings and retreats.
